Counselling

Counseling is a type of therapeutic process that involves talking with a trained professional to address personal and psychological challenges. The goal of counseling is to provide support, guidance, and insight to individuals who are experiencing emotional, behavioral, or mental health difficulties.

Counseling is usually a collaborative process between the individual and the counselor. During a counseling session, the counselor creates a safe, non-judgmental, and confidential space for the individual to explore their thoughts, feelings, and experiences. The counselor listens attentively and offers feedback and guidance to help the individual gain insight, manage their emotions, and resolve their difficulties.

Counseling can be used to treat a wide range of issues, including anxiety, depression, stress, relationship problems, grief, trauma, and behavioral issues. The therapy is often tailored to the specific needs of the individual, and the counselor may use a variety of therapeutic approaches, including cognitive-behavioral therapy, humanistic therapy, and psychodynamic therapy.

In conclusion, counseling is a type of therapeutic process that provides support, guidance, and insight to individuals who are experiencing emotional, behavioral, or mental health difficulties. By working with a trained counselor, individuals can gain greater understanding and insight into their difficulties, develop effective coping strategies, and make positive changes in their lives.
